CIVIL NO. 1:16-CV-501
(Chief Judge Conner)
ORDER
AND NOW, this 6th day of February, 2018, upon consideration of defendants’
motion (Doc. 36) to dismiss the second amended complaint in part, and in
accordance with the court’s memorandum of same date, it is hereby ORDERED
that the motion (Doc. 36) is GRANTED in its entirety as follows:
1.
The motion is GRANTED with respect to the Fourteenth Amendment
due process and equal protection claims, the Eighth Amendment
conditions of confinement claim, and the Monell claim. These claims
are DISMISSED in their entirety.
2.
The motion is GRANTED as to any claim for damages under the
Pennsylvania Constitution. This claim is DISMISSED in its entirety.
3.
The claims against defendants James Smink and Brian Wheary are
dismissed in their entirety. The Clerk of Court is directed to
TERMINATE these defendants.
